What is the best way to skip records at the beginning of a spoolfile when
printing to a network printer?

Can I specify something in NPCONFIG or perhaps my startup_file?

When using NBSPOOL from Netbase, you can say START=3 and it will ignore the
first 3 records (not pages) and this is what I need to mimic via MPE/iX.

Any help would be appreciated.
